Technological Advancements in the Industry

The latest generation of pick and place machines integrates vision inspection systems, AI-based calibration, and IoT-enabled analytics for real-time performance monitoring. These advancements enhance accuracy and ensure seamless production in complex circuit board designs. Manufacturers are investing in modular machines that offer flexibility for different component sizes and PCB configurations. Robotics has also revolutionized the market, enabling adaptive motion control and reduced setup times. The shift from manual assembly to robotic automation has increased throughput and ensured consistent quality across production batches.

Market Segmentation

The pick and place machine market is segmented by type, application, and end-use industry. Based on type, it includes high-speed chip shooters, flexible placement systems, and multi-functional machines. The application segment covers consumer electronics, automotive electronics, industrial equipment, and medical devices. Among these, the consumer electronics segment dominates due to high-volume production needs and continuous innovation in miniaturization. The automotive and industrial sectors are expected to show strong growth due to the increasing integration of sensors, controllers, and power electronics in modern systems.

FAQs

Q1: What are pick and place machines used for?
Pick and place machines are used in electronics manufacturing to automatically place components onto printed circuit boards with high precision.

Q2: Which industry primarily uses pick and place machines?
The consumer electronics industry is the major user, though automotive, aerospace, and industrial sectors also rely on these machines.

Q3: What technologies are shaping the future of this market?
AI, IoT, robotics, and machine vision are key technologies revolutionizing the pick and place machine industry.
